The Softer Side of Paint Prep
We designed our 3M Hookit Painter's Abrasive Disc Back-up Pad for auto body sanding jobs requiring finer abrasive grades such as prep sanding for color, primer and clear coat, where added support and control are important. The 6” diameter soft-density foam body has a 15° taper for flexibility when sanding along contours or close to edges. The disc pad features 5/16-24 external threads which are compatible with orbital or random orbital sanders that have 5/16-24 internal threads.Our Hookit Attachment System
The Hookit hook-and-loop feature makes disc attachment, removal, and re-attachment clean and easy, and facilitates use and re-use of the disc for the extent of the abrasive life. Hookit disc pads have J-shaped hooks of the type most commonly used in everyday hook-and-loop applications. Hookit disc pads grip the brushed nylon loop backings of 3M Hookit discs and provide a finer finish than do adhesive backed discs. The Hookit system is designed for work spaces where adhesive backed discs may become contaminated by dust, dirt, or flying debris.Science for Better Sanding from 3M
